These Washington cities sit on very different water

Seattle and Tacoma are the Puget Sound side of the state, while Spokane sits out on the rolling plains of eastern Washington. Spokane's water is the Spokane River, which runs through a gorge and over Spokane Falls in the middle of downtown, with the 100-acre Riverfront Park laid out on an old railyard alongside. Picture the water you expect to see on this trip. If it is the Sound, you are booking west; if it is a river and a waterfall inside a city park, you are booking Spokane.

Spokane is a separate eastern choice, not a nearby alternative. It sits about 280 road miles east of Seattle and about 290 from Tacoma, so choosing a side of the state comes before choosing a room. Flights land out east as well, at Spokane International Airport, the second largest airport in Washington.

A historic market and the Rainier gateway share Puget Sound

The market half is Pike Place Market, a nine-acre historic district at 85 Pike Street that opened in 1907. It overlooks Puget Sound, and if wandering those nine acres is what the trip is for, Seattle is your city.

Tacoma is the gateway to Mount Rainier, and it has a Puget Sound waterfront of its own. For a trip built around Mount Rainier, Tacoma is the city to book, not Seattle.

Even the airport is named for both cities, Seattle-Tacoma International, and its street address is in SeaTac, a separate city, so where you land does not decide between Seattle and Tacoma. The two cities sit only about 34 road miles apart. Decide by the market or the mountain, and check in at 18 in the city you picked.
